A Mega Millions ticket gave a lucky lottery winner an estimated $1.22 billion jackpot this holiday season.

The ticket sold in Cottonwood, California, matched all six numbers from Dec. 27’s drawing, according to a news release from the Mega Millions consortium of lotteries Saturday.

A $1 million prize ticket was also sold in Arizona. The prize is based on the ticket matching the numbers of the five white balls, which were 3, 7, 37, 49, and 55. The number on the sixth, yellow ball was 6.

This was the fourth Mega Millions jackpot win this year and the fifth-largest Mega Millions jackpot in history.

The next drawing was scheduled for Dec. 31 and the jackpot has reset to an estimated $20 million top prize. There has never been a Mega Millions jackpot winner on New Year’s Eve, according to the lottery.

Drawings are conducted at 11 p.m. Eastern time/8 p.m. Arizona time.
